Definition(s) for: 多头

Hanzi Pinyin Definition(s)
多头 duō tóu - many-headed
- many-layered (authority)
- devolved (as opposed to centralized)
- pluralistic
- (as classifier) number of animals
- long term (finance)
- long (investment)
